Baked Orange Chicken with Rosemary and Potatoes

Prep: 15min
| Servings: 4 | Cook: 50min

Ingredients

  • 1 chicken (ca. 1 kg)
  • Salt
  • Pepper (freshly ground)
  • paprika powder
  • 0.5 tsp Curry Powder
  • 0.5 tsp cumin
  • 4 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 untreated orange
  • 1 bay leaf
  • 2 rosemary sprigs
  • 750 g firm boiling potatoes
  • 250 ml vegetable or poultry broth

Instructions

    Preheat oven to 220 °C. Wash chicken, pat dry and cut into 8 pieces, removing breastbone and spine. Season chicken pieces with salt, pepper, curry and cumin. Rinse orange hot, dry peel, halve and slice or chop with peel. Brush a deep baking tray with half the oil, arrange chicken pieces on it and bake for 20 minutes in preheated oven.

    Wash rosemary, shake dry and break into several pieces. Peel, wash potatoes, slice, pat dry, salt and pepper. Turn chicken pieces and add potatoes and rosemary to the baking tray. Bake everything together for another 20 minutes, turning occasionally. Pour broth over and bake for an additional 10 minutes. Serve with white bread.
